The Fundamentals of Blockchain Technology

Blockchain serves as the underlying technology supporting crypto ledgers. It is a distributed and decentralized digital ledger that records all transactions across multiple computers or nodes. The blockchain technology's remarkable feature lies in its ability to ensure immutability and trust in the absence of a central authority.


Types of Crypto Ledgers

1. Public Ledgers

Public ledgers, as the name suggests, are open to anyone who wishes to validate or participate in the network. Bitcoin, the pioneering cryptocurrency, operates on a public ledger.

2. Private Ledgers

Private ledgers, in contrast to public ledgers, restrict access to selected participants. They are commonly utilized in enterprises or organizations seeking to maintain control over transaction visibility.

3. Consortium Ledgers

Consortium ledgers are a hybrid between public and private ledgers. They involve a pre-selected group of participants who possess the authority to validate transactions, resulting in enhanced efficiency.
